Median − ETF below zero means the typical name is lagging the cap-weighted index — the move is top-heavy. "Beat" counts constituents outperforming the ETF over the window. Dispersion is the cross-sectional standard deviation of constituent returns — high = a stock-picker's tape, low = pure beta.
